diff options
author | Tobrun <tobrun.van.nuland@gmail.com> | 2016-09-29 11:41:08 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2016-09-29 11:41:08 +0200 |
commit | c97a1047dfabe06cd87a0d1bb6dfd855f9727629 (patch) | |
tree | 96b295b9fa1ea347e9d92f99cf2525e1d4611210 /plat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/camera/CameraUpdateFactory.java | |
parent | 1777b8757a437d6f27928c2bb3d821fc8679cf20 (diff) | |
download | qtlocation-mapboxgl-c97a1047dfabe06cd87a0d1bb6dfd855f9727629.tar.gz |
6453 restore tilt after orientation (#6491)
* [android] - correct tilt value when restoring activity or creating from xml
* correct values requesting camera position adhoc
* updated logic change in unit tests
Diffstat (limited to 'plat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/camera/CameraUpdateFactory.java')
-rw-r--r-- | plat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/camera/CameraUpdateFactory.java |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/camera/CameraUpdateFactory.java b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/camera/CameraUpdateFactory.java index 028d077a09..73e67270ae 100644 --- a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/camera/CameraUpdateFactory.java +++ b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/camera/CameraUpdateFactory.java @@ -184,8 +184,8 @@ public final class CameraUpdateFactory { public CameraPosition getCameraPosition(@NonNull MapboxMap mapboxMap) { CameraPosition previousPosition = mapboxMap.getCameraPosition(); if (target == null) { - return new CameraPosition.Builder(true) - .tilt(tilt) + return new CameraPosition.Builder() + .tilt(Math.toDegrees(tilt)) .zoom(zoom) .bearing(bearing) .target(previousPosition.target) @@ -310,8 +310,8 @@ public final class CameraUpdateFactory { .bearing(previousPosition.bearing) .build(); } else { - return new CameraPosition.Builder(true) - .tilt(previousPosition.tilt) + return new CameraPosition.Builder() + .tilt(Math.toDegrees(previousPosition.tilt)) .zoom(previousPosition.zoom) .bearing(previousPosition.bearing) .target(previousPosition.target) |